For a statistical perspective of global traffic flows on a large network, we have proposed a way to infer unobservable statistics of each flow from measurements of aggregated-flows (sums of flows), which are easily measured at some links (router interfaces) in the network. In this paper, to relax some limitations in the previous work, we discuss some improvement: i) determining minimum rates of flows, ii) indirectly inferring statistics of some flows from those of other flows, iii) rounding (quantization) by an adequate bin size, and show simulation results, which indicate effectiveness of our improvement.
